Ticket Office Issues Resolved

Further to today's announcement regarding the network outage at Craven Cottage, we are pleased to inform supporters that the Club's ticketing system is now back up and running.

The network outage caused issues with the Ticket Office emails and phone lines (both inbound and outbound) on Friday 6th August but the issue has now been resolved. The Fulham FC Ticket Office will endeavour to respond to supporter enquiries as soon as possible and we ask for patience during this time whilst we work through them.

Supporters wishing to purchase tickets for Sunday's match against Middlesbrough can do so online by visiting tickets.fulhamfc.com.

We would like to remind supporters that all tickets must have been printed at home in advance of matchday as there will be no facility at Craven Cottage to print match tickets. To print tickets fans should log in to their OneFulham Account, navigate to their ticketing profile and click 'Order History'.

We encourage supporters to arrive as early as possible on Sunday and apologise for any inconvenience caused.
